A SIMPLE MODEL FOR ORIENTATIONAL ORDERING OF A SILVER MONOLAYER ELECTRODEPOSITED ON A C(0001) SURFACE

Abstract: The model for the angular orientational energy (AOE) has been extended to hexagonal submonolayer domains of Ag electrodeposited at a constant overpotential on a C(0001) surface. These domains which are characterized by an epitaxy angleθ=15±5°and anAg−AgdistancedAg−Ag=0.330± 0.016 nm, can be considered as precursors of 3DAgcrystal formation, according to a Volmer-Weber type mechanism. Calculations are based upon a simple Hamiltonian evaluated by introducing the concept of the commensurable unit cell. A Fourier series expansion for the substrate potential was used. Results from the model predict the existence of a commensurable cell in agreement with the experimental data derived from STM imaging.
